LOUSY GPS SYSTEM, DEALER REPLACED UNIT AND ANTENNA BUT STILL SAME PROBLEMS. ELEVATION INFORMATION USUALLY WRONG, TAKES EXCESSIVE TIME FOR GPS UNIT TO ACCURATELY FIND LOCATION. I SPENT A LOT OF MONEY FOR A TOURING MODEL AND GOT A PIECE OF JUNK FOR NAVIGATION. NOW THE DEALER HAS NO RESOLUTION SINCE FIELD REP FOR HONDA WILL NOT HELP. I WILL PROBABLY NOT BUY ANOTHER HONDA. THIS IS MY 6TH HONDA IN 9 YEARS.

I got in my car in the morning to go to work and my navigation screen was shattered. I did not physically damage the screen, nor did I even drive my car the day before. It was locked in my home driveway. Nothing would work. I tried to submit a claim for the extended warranty I purchased but they denied it because they felt it was caused by physical damage. There isn't a scratch or mark on the outer screen so it imploded from the inside. I think it was caused by the extreme heat in Florida.
I'm very disappointed that Honda or Fidelity will not honor my claim. I bought the Touring edition of this car for all of its features, so my car is pretty much worthless without this getting fixed.
